NGUYỄN NHẬT ANH
Giới thiệu về bản thân
def ucln(a, b): while b != 0: a, b = b, a % b return a # Nhập 2 số tự nhiên từ bàn phím a = int(input("Nhập số a: ")) b = int(input("Nhập số b: ")) # Gọi hàm UCLN và in kết quả print("Ước chung lớn nhất là:", ucln(a, b))
while True: try: a = float(input("Nhập số thực dương a: ")) if a > 0: break else: print("Số vừa nhập chưa phải số thực dương. Hãy nhập lại.") except: print("Số vừa nhập chưa phải số thực dương. Hãy nhập lại.") # Tính bình phương binh_phuong = a ** 2 # In kết quả, lấy 2 số sau dấu phẩy print("Bình phương của a là:", round(binh_phuong, 2))
x = 10.5 y = 20.9 if x < y: print("x nhỏ hơn y")
# Nhập n
n = int(input("Nhập số tự nhiên n: "))
# Tính tổng S bằng vòng lặp for
S = 0
for i in range(1, n + 1):
S = S + i * i # i^2
# Tính T theo công thức
T = n * (n + 1) * (2 * n + 1) // 6 # Dùng // để lấy số nguyên
# In kết quả
print("Tổng S =", S)
print("Giá trị T =", T)
# So sánh
if S == T:
print("S và T bằng nhau")
else:
print("S và T KHÁC nhau")
# Nhập n
n = int(input("Nhập số tự nhiên n: "))
# Tính tổng S bằng vòng lặp for
S = 0
for i in range(1, n + 1):
S = S + i * i # i^2
# Tính T theo công thức
T = n * (n + 1) * (2 * n + 1) // 6 # Dùng // để lấy số nguyên
# In kết quả
print("Tổng S =", S)
print("Giá trị T =", T)
# So sánh
if S == T:
print("S và T bằng nhau")
else:
print("S và T KHÁC nhau")
# Nhập ngày, tháng, năm
ngay = int(input("Nhập ngày: "))
thang = int(input("Nhập tháng: "))
nam = int(input("Nhập năm: "))
# Kiểm tra năm nhuận
if (nam % 4 == 0 and nam % 100 != 0) or (nam % 400 == 0):
nam_nhuan = True
else:
nam_nhuan = False
# Khởi tạo số ngày
tong_ngay = 0
# Cộng ngày của các tháng trước
if thang > 1:
tong_ngay += 31
if thang > 2:
if nam_nhuan:
tong_ngay += 29
else:
tong_ngay += 28
if thang > 3:
tong_ngay += 31
if thang > 4:
tong_ngay += 30
if thang > 5:
tong_ngay += 31
if thang > 6:
tong_ngay += 30
if thang > 7:
tong_ngay += 31
if thang > 8:
tong_ngay += 31
if thang > 9:
tong_ngay += 30
if thang > 10:
tong_ngay += 31
if thang > 11:
tong_ngay += 30
# Cộng thêm ngày hiện tại
tong_ngay += ngay
# In kết quả
print("Từ đầu năm đến ngày", ngay, "/", thang, "/", nam, "là", tong_ngay, "ngày.")
# Nhập ngày, tháng, năm
ngay = int(input("Nhập ngày: "))
thang = int(input("Nhập tháng: "))
nam = int(input("Nhập năm: "))
# Kiểm tra năm nhuận
if (nam % 4 == 0 and nam % 100 != 0) or (nam % 400 == 0):
nam_nhuan = True
else:
nam_nhuan = False
# Khởi tạo số ngày
tong_ngay = 0
# Cộng ngày của các tháng trước
if thang > 1:
tong_ngay += 31
if thang > 2:
if nam_nhuan:
tong_ngay += 29
else:
tong_ngay += 28
if thang > 3:
tong_ngay += 31
if thang > 4:
tong_ngay += 30
if thang > 5:
tong_ngay += 31
if thang > 6:
tong_ngay += 30
if thang > 7:
tong_ngay += 31
if thang > 8:
tong_ngay += 31
if thang > 9:
tong_ngay += 30
if thang > 10:
tong_ngay += 31
if thang > 11:
tong_ngay += 30
# Cộng thêm ngày hiện tại
tong_ngay += ngay
# In kết quả
print("Từ đầu năm đến ngày", ngay, "/", thang, "/", nam, "là", tong_ngay, "ngày.")
nó kiểu là con bé thì bị con to ăn thịt í
# Nhập ngày, tháng, năm
ngay = int(input("Nhập ngày: "))
thang = int(input("Nhập tháng: "))
nam = int(input("Nhập năm: "))
# Kiểm tra năm nhuận
if (nam % 4 == 0 and nam % 100 != 0) or (nam % 400 == 0):
nam_nhuan = True
else:
nam_nhuan = False
# Khởi tạo số ngày
tong_ngay = 0
# Cộng ngày của các tháng trước
if thang > 1:
tong_ngay += 31
if thang > 2:
if nam_nhuan:
tong_ngay += 29
else:
tong_ngay += 28
if thang > 3:
tong_ngay += 31
if thang > 4:
tong_ngay += 30
if thang > 5:
tong_ngay += 31
if thang > 6:
tong_ngay += 30
if thang > 7:
tong_ngay += 31
if thang > 8:
tong_ngay += 31
if thang > 9:
tong_ngay += 30
if thang > 10:
tong_ngay += 31
if thang > 11:
tong_ngay += 30
# Cộng thêm ngày hiện tại
tong_ngay += ngay
# In kết quả
print("Từ đầu năm đến ngày", ngay, "/", thang, "/", nam, "là", tong_ngay, "ngày.")
# Nhập ngày, tháng, năm
ngay = int(input("Nhập ngày: "))
thang = int(input("Nhập tháng: "))
nam = int(input("Nhập năm: "))
# Kiểm tra năm nhuận
if (nam % 4 == 0 and nam % 100 != 0) or (nam % 400 == 0):
nam_nhuan = True
else:
nam_nhuan = False
# Khởi tạo số ngày
tong_ngay = 0
# Cộng ngày của các tháng trước
if thang > 1:
tong_ngay += 31
if thang > 2:
if nam_nhuan:
tong_ngay += 29
else:
tong_ngay += 28
if thang > 3:
tong_ngay += 31
if thang > 4:
tong_ngay += 30
if thang > 5:
tong_ngay += 31
if thang > 6:
tong_ngay += 30
if thang > 7:
tong_ngay += 31
if thang > 8:
tong_ngay += 31
if thang > 9:
tong_ngay += 30
if thang > 10:
tong_ngay += 31
if thang > 11:
tong_ngay += 30
# Cộng thêm ngày hiện tại
tong_ngay += ngay
# In kết quả
print("Từ đầu năm đến ngày", ngay, "/", thang, "/", nam, "là", tong_ngay, "ngày.")